Job Description Signal Tru Brand

is seeking a detail-oriented and articulate

Communications Associate

to support our internal and external communication efforts. The ideal candidate will play a key role in ensuring consistent messaging across all communication channels and supporting project execution across departments. You will work closely with leadership, operations, and client service teams to craft clear, professional, and brand-aligned content that strengthens our voice and supports organizational goals.

Responsibilities

Develop, edit, and proofread written content including reports, presentations, emails, and corporate documents.

Assist in coordinating internal communications and support leadership in messaging initiatives.

Maintain consistency in brand tone and language across all communication pieces.

Collaborate with departments to translate complex concepts into clear and actionable communication.

Prepare materials for meetings, trainings, and stakeholder briefings.

Track communication KPIs and provide input to improve strategies.

Assist in managing internal documents and content libraries.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in Communications, English, Journalism, or a related field.

1–3 years of professional experience in communications, copywriting, or content creation.

Exceptional writing, editing, and proofreading skills.

Strong organizational skills and ability to manage multiple projects with attention to detail.

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and basic document formatting tools.

Ability to work independently and communicate effectively in a team-oriented environment.

Benefits

Competitive salary: $58,000 — $64,000 annually
